Lake Leman

Also found in: Dictionary, Medical, Encyclopedia, Wikipedia.
Graphic Thesaurus  🔍
Display ON
Animation ON
  • noun

Synonyms for Lake Leman

a lake between southwestern Switzerland and France that is crossed from east to west by the Rhone

References in periodicals archive ?
The best views of Yvoire and the majestic mountain backdrop are from Lake Leman.
Located between Lake Leman and Mont Blanc, Abundance falls into an altitude range that scientists say is experiencing fewer days of snowfall.
ch is on course for manufacturing as an experimental platform which plans to sail on Lake Leman in 2010 spring.
At 930metres (3,051ft), Abondance in the French Alps, between Mont Blanc and Lake Leman, falls in the altitude range which climate scientists say has seen the most dramatic drop in snowfall in recent generations.
Out of the Meadowlake mare Lake Leman, the dark bay filly is closely related to the multiple stakes winner Wild Gale.
The waiter, who works in an upmarket hotel beside Lake Leman near Evian, went to work on Saturday because he was not sure he had won.
Lake Leman lies by Chillon's walls: A thousand feet in depth below Its massy waters meet and flow; Thus much the fathom-line was sent From Chillon's snow-white battlement, Which round about the wave enthralls.